Selecting the Right Card for You | Prepaid vs. Debit
Navigating your world of financial tools can be challenging. Two popular options are prepaid and debit cards, both offering convenience for everyday transactions. However, understanding their differences is crucial to selecting the card that best satisfies your needs. Prepaid cards operate by loading a predetermined amount onto the card, while debit cards are instantly linked to your bank account, permitting you to spend funds accessible in your account.
- Consider your spending habits and budget: Do you prefer setting limits on your expenses? A prepaid card could be appropriate.
- Assess your need for access to funds: If you require immediate access to your money, a debit card might be a more suitable option.
- Research the fees and features associated with each type of card: Some cards may charge monthly maintenance fees, spending fees, or ATM withdrawal fees.
Ultimately, the best card for you depends on your individual circumstances. By carefully considering the benefits and drawbacks of both prepaid and debit cards, you can make an informed choice that aligns with your financial goals.
